Transaction 104c8d540a177e71938ad948d2bf7a8b93c25c06fdc7cdc2880e96f0e685cc96

4 Input
2 Outputs
  • 104c8d540a177e71938ad948d2bf7a8b93c25c06fdc7cdc2880e96f0e685cc96:0
  • value  267796
    address  1FBaa1UhskezVMSYcTuxTcVAwycyuY9rhD
  • 104c8d540a177e71938ad948d2bf7a8b93c25c06fdc7cdc2880e96f0e685cc96:1
  • value  3908492
    address  3GqQaCJPRccS47NirkbmJqZuBtUBLgaDmu